I had heard about ARAN bakery for a while and had been wanting to go once I heard about their sourdough and sweet delights. Unfortunately it’s not very often I am passing Dunkeld so when I was at one of the near Highland Games I took my opportunity. As expected the shop was busy but I purposely left early so I was committed and willing to wait if I had to. The shop was a little smaller than I expected and so it was quite snuggly in there with all the people. My greediness took over and I went full rogue. The anticipation probably didn’t help my gluttony. I picked up a sourdough loaf to start and I then seen the focaccia so I couldn’t resist buying that. For the sweet treats I wanted to see how their almond croissant and cardamom bun compared to what I’ve had in the past. I was then drawn to the cupcake with blackberry and frosting. Their blondie and brownie had to be tried also. Finally, I seen they were doing a kimchi cheese toastie so I naturally went for that because I clearly hadn’t ordered enough. Despite being tempted, I didn’t eat all items at once, because I didn’t want it to hinder performance at the Highland Games. But I had to eat something right away. I didn’t want to eat the toastie cold so I went for that first. It was quite nice. However I would’ve liked more cheese and less kimchi. Both were tasty but the ratio for me was off. The toasted sourdough was good but maybe a bit dry. I personally prefer a slightly messy/juicy toastie. Next up was the almond croissant. This was delectable. Beautiful pastry with a lovely filling. Good crisp on the outer and soft centre. It wasn’t overly sweet either. I’ve had a fair few almond croissants in my days and this is definitely in my top 5, maybe 3. That was enough food pre comp. For Intra-comp fuel I decided to have the focaccia and the cardamom bun. Both were excellent but probably a bit too heavy for during a competition. The focaccia was thick and had a beautiful golden crust. The oil and herbs gave a lovely flavour. If I were being picky, there could’ve been a bit more of an open crump, making it a bit airier and less chewy. The cardamom bun was excellent. Attractive to eye with its tight consistent shaping. The texture was soft and had a nice glaze, but maybe could’ve had a bit more caramelisation. I didn’t get a strong cardamom flavour but it was very enjoyable. Later, I had the cream topped brioche which was yummy and had a rich creamy frosting and the hint of blackberry was a nice addition. Finally, my post comp snacks were the blondie and the brownie. The blondie was sweet with hints of almond throughout. The crumb was dense but moist with lots of flavour and had a slight crisp on top. Lastly, the brownie was pretty good and was loaded with different nuts and seeds. It had a nice chocolate flavour and the contrast between the textures was admired. However, I prefer brownies to be gooey and this was firmer and maybe a little dry. Overall Aran is popular for reason. The staff were also friendly and accommodating, despite the busyness. It’s a very good bakery and definitely worth visiting if you’re passing. I certainly don’t mind paying that bit extra for extra bit of quality.

I’m glad to have made this one of my stops on my way up North. I got the Pork and Apple Sausage Roll, £4.25 and the Cardamom Bun, £4. They both look incredible and it’s backed up by the flavours. The sausage roll had a light but crumbly pastry and great quality meat inside. Perhaps looking more for the apple flavour but still a great wee treat. The cardamom bun was incredible, I was transported back to Copenhagen with my first bite. These were a staple when I lived there and this one was as good as any I’ve had over there!
